A man has been arrested and charged after police said he assaulted a DART bus driver, leaving her with serious injuries in Newark, Delaware.
According to Delaware State Police, on Thursday, December 4, 2025, around 1:00 p.m., troopers responded to Peoples Plaza in Newark for a report of an assault.
Police said when troopers arrived on scene, they learned that a woman, who is a DART bus driver, had been assaulted by a man later identified as 22-year-old Larry Bryant.
The investigation revealed that the driver was returning to her bus from a nearby business when Bryant allegedly began following her, making her feel uncomfortable, according to police.
The bus driver asked Bryant to stop following her and attempted to dial 911 after Bryant refused. Police said that’s when Bryant struck the bus driver in the face before fleeing.
Police said the bus driver was taken to a nearby hospital and treated for serious injuries.
According to police, troopers found Bryant inside a theater at Regal Cinemas and arrested him without incident.
Police added that they learned Bryant also did not pay to enter the theater.
Bryant was taken into custody and charged with felony assault second degree causing injury to a public transit operator and theft of services under $1500.
